A.K.A. Pella presents “2012 The Year in Review” is here!
2012 was a big year for Jewish music, featuring many big releases and a number of mega hit songs that made their mark on Jewish music lovers everywhere.
Now, Jewish music lovers unite, and get ready for an all out non-stop presentation of the years’ biggest hits (and maybe some that you may never have even heard before : ) with yes……. those signature A.K.A. Pella twists and turns which never cease to amaze.
All the hits, all the top songs are here, featuring some new sets of amazing song combos, fantastically creative medleys, stunning harmonies and incredible voices.

Featuring songs from Yaakov Shwekey, Avraham Fried, Lipa, 8th Day, break out sensations Shloime Taussig and Shauly Waldner, and yes of course the most popular song of the year, Yesh Tikvah!

Fasten your seat belt folks, you’re in for a ride!

The album is in stores now and distributed by Sameach Music and available on their website JewishJukebox.com
